Mainland vs Free Zone: The Core Decision in 2026

Every business setup conversation in Dubai starts here, and it's the single most important decision you'll make.

Mainland companies, licensed through Dubai's Department of Economy and Tourism (DET), can trade freely anywhere in the UAE, bid on government contracts, and open physical retail locations without restriction. Since 2021, most mainland activities also allow 100% foreign ownership, removing the old requirement for a local Emirati sponsor.

Free zone companies are ideal for online businesses, consultants, tech startups, and international trading companies. They offer full foreign ownership, streamlined registration, and — depending on the zone — access to strong banking and networking ecosystems. The trade-off is that free zone companies generally cannot sell directly into the UAE mainland market without appointing a local distributor or opening a mainland branch.

A rough rule of thumb for 2026:

  • Choose mainland if you need a physical shop, want government contracts, or plan to serve UAE-based clients directly.
  • Choose a free zone if you're running an online business, a consultancy, or an international trading operation and want the lowest-cost, fastest setup.

On the tax side, the UAE applies 0% corporate tax on taxable income up to AED 375,000, and 9% above that threshold, with certain free zone entities potentially qualifying for continued 0% treatment under the Qualifying Free Zone Person (QFZP) regime — a detail your consultant should confirm applies to your specific activity.

The Business Setup Process, Step by Step

  1. Define your business activity – This determines which authority and license category you need.
  2. Choose your jurisdiction – Mainland, free zone, or offshore, based on your trading needs.
  3. Reserve a trade name – Must comply with UAE naming conventions.
  4. Apply for initial approval – Confirms the government has no objection to your business activity.
  5. Draft your MOA/license application – Your consultant typically prepares this on your behalf.
  6. Secure office space or a flexi-desk – Required for most license types.
  7. Pay license fees and receive your trade license – Often issued within a few days to two weeks.
  8. Apply for visas and open a corporate bank account – The final step before you're fully operational.

How to Choose the Right Business Setup Consultant

Not all consultants are equal, and the market has grown crowded. Look for these signs of a trustworthy partner:

  • Transparent, itemized pricing rather than "packages" that hide extra fees
  • Experience across both mainland and free zone setups — not just one they earn higher commissions on
  • Banking relationships to help with the often-difficult corporate account opening process
  • Post-setup support, including VAT registration, accounting, and license renewals
  • Verifiable client reviews and a physical Dubai office you can visit

Be cautious of consultants who push you toward the cheapest free zone without asking about your actual clients and revenue model — the lowest sticker price isn't always the lowest total cost of ownership over three years.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does it cost to hire a business setup consultant in Dubai?

Many consultants bundle their advisory fee into the overall setup package rather than charging separately, though some charge a flat consultation fee ranging from AED 500–3,000 for standalone advice.

Is a free zone or mainland license better for a small business?

It depends on your customer base — free zones suit online and international businesses, while mainland suits those trading directly within the UAE.

How long does business setup take in Dubai in 2026?

Most licenses are issued within a few days to two weeks once documentation is complete, though bank account opening can take several additional weeks.

Do I need a local sponsor to open a business in Dubai?

No — since 2021, most mainland and free zone activities allow 100% foreign ownership.
